Transaction 90e673d037d60584a4c13a2de6338259d05bda155a40c03ce281383fdf1fafd3
1 Input
1 Output
-
90e673d037d60584a4c13a2de6338259d05bda155a40c03ce281383fdf1fafd3:0
- value
- 140270833
- script pubkey
- OP_0 OP_PUSHBYTES_20 44f80f968cc80bce7cffda47d31bf9387f2ff3b6
- address
- bc1qgnuql95veq9uul8lmfraxxle8pljluak2s3mue